Owo Massacre Cenotaph Demolition: Direct all attacks to me, not Aiyedatiwa – Olowo of Owo

Following the outrage trailing the demolition of the memorial park built to immortalise massacred victims of St Francis Xavier Catholic Church, Owo, Ondo State, the Olowo of Owo, Oba Ajibade Ogunoye, has claimed he requested the demolition of the monument.

The monarch, who stated that Governor Lucky Aiyedatiwa only executed the complaint of the palace over the location of the memorial park, urged that the governor not be held responsible.

He urged all aggrieved persons to channel their attacks and anger at the palace.

The Olowo in a statement, said late former Governor Oluwarotimi Akeredolu who conceptualized and built the monument ‘defiantly’ ignored the objection of the palace and the people of Owo over the citing of the cenotaph opposite the palace.

The Olowo’s claims is, however, at variance with an earlier position of the former CPS to late Akeredolu, Richard Olatunde, who revealed that the Olowo of Owo actually gave his late boss the consent to build the project.

Ogunoye emphasised that the location of the memorial park within the proximity of the palace is not in conformity with the age-long culture and traditions of the ancient town under any guise of celebrating the dead.

The traditional ruler also stated that youths and some concerned stakeholders had protested against the development but the late Akeredolu disregarded the plea.

“The Palace wishes to say unequivocally that the request for this action was at the instance of His Imperial Majesty, Olowo of Owo and the entire good people of the kingdom.

“It must be made clear that the decision to site the structure in that particular location was resisted by the Olowo-in-Council and frowned upon by the people of the community when it was being conceived.

“We advise anyone with any issues whatsoever against the demolition to make the palace their target and not the listening Governor, Lucky Orimisan Aiyedatiwa, who is not in anyway responsible for the demolition.”
